# Virginia HB 1371 (2020) — TANF; diversionary cash assistance.
TANF; diversionary cash assistance. Imposes a minimum threshold of $1,500 on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) diversionary cash assistance. The bill provides that any person who receives TANF diversionary cash assistance waives his eligibility for TANF for the number of days for which assistance is granted multiplied by 1.33. The bill also requires the Board of Social Services to adopt regulations to enable TANF-eligible applicants meeting certain criteria to receive a TANF emergency assistance payment of up to $1,500 to prevent eviction or to address needs resulting from a fire or natural disaster.

##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2020-01-08** Prefiled and ordered printed; offered 01/08/20 20102506D `introduction`
- **2020-01-08** Referred to Committee on Health, Welfare and Institutions `referral-committee`
- **2020-01-14** Assigned HWI sub: Social Services `referral-committee`
- **2020-01-15** Impact statement from DPB (HB1371)
- **2020-01-16** Subcommittee recommends reporting (6-Y 0-N)
- **2020-01-16** Subcommittee recommends referring to Committee on Appropriations
- **2020-01-21** Reported from Health, Welfare and Institutions (22-Y 0-N) `committee-passage`
- **2020-01-21** Referred to Committee on Appropriations `referral-committee`
- **2020-01-22** Assigned App. sub: Health & Human Resources `referral-committee`
- **2020-02-05** Subcommittee recommends reporting with amendments (8-Y 0-N)
- **2020-02-05** House committee, floor amendments and substitutes offered
- **2020-02-05** Reported from Appropriations with amendments (21-Y 0-N) `committee-passage`
- **2020-02-06** Read first time `reading-1`
- **2020-02-07** Read second time `reading-2`
- **2020-02-07** Committee amendments agreed to
- **2020-02-07** Engrossed by House as amended HB1371E
- **2020-02-07** Printed as engrossed 20102506D-E
- **2020-02-10** Read third time and passed House BLOCK VOTE (99-Y 0-N) `passage, reading-3`
- **2020-02-10** VOTE: Block Vote Passage (99-Y 0-N)
- **2020-02-11** Constitutional reading dispensed
- **2020-02-11** Referred to Committee on Rehabilitation and Social Services `referral-committee`
- **2020-02-14** Impact statement from DPB (HB1371E)
- **2020-02-21** Reported from Rehabilitation and Social Services (15-Y 0-N) `committee-passage`
- **2020-02-24** Constitutional reading dispensed (40-Y 0-N)
- **2020-02-25** Read third time `reading-3`
- **2020-02-25** Passed Senate (40-Y 0-N) `passage`
- **2020-03-02** Enrolled
- **2020-03-02** Impact statement from DPB (HB1371ER)
- **2020-03-02** Signed by Speaker
- **2020-03-03** Signed by President
- **2020-03-12** Enrolled Bill communicated to Governor on March 12, 2020
- **2020-03-12** Governor's Action Deadline 11:59 p.m., April 11, 2020
- **2020-04-11** Approved by Governor-Chapter 1159 (effective 7/1/20) `executive-signature`
